Guilds St Mary's has five Guilds. The main focus of their
activities differs.
St.
Elizabeth Ann Seton
Guildis a guild for women. This guild exists
primarily to promote fellowship, friendship, and personal
and spiritual growth during
a woman's middle age years.
St. Francis
Guildseeks to unite and offer mutual support to the women of the parish involved in a variety of civic and community
activities.
St.
Helena's Guildoffers a social gathering for women in
their "upper years".
St.
Jude's Guild is open to young women who want to assist one another in times of need and help each other to grow deeper in our Catholic faith.
Trinity
Guild is unique in that it is open to both men and women who wish to assist others in the parish by planning, setting up, and serving receptions in the Parish Hall or Parish Center.

Scouting at St. Mary's St Mary's has promoted and provided Scout guidance since
1926. Thanks to great participation from Adult leadership
and involvement, our scouting program in equal to any.
Besides the regular Scouting awards, St. Mary's always has a
higher than average number of scouts gaining religious awards
such as The Light of Christ Emblem, Parvuli Dei Emblem, Pope
Pius XII, and I Live My Faith Emblem.
